What is a VRLA Battery?

A VRLA (Valve Regulated Lead Acid) battery is a type of sealed lead-acid battery that doesn’t require maintenance like traditional flooded batteries. The key feature of VRLA batteries is their sealed design, which prevents acid leaks and minimizes the need for regular water refilling. These batteries are used widely in applications such as solar power systems, backup power for telecom towers, and more. The Secret Inside: Valve Regulation and AGM Technology

At the heart of every VRLA battery is its valve-regulated design. Unlike traditional flooded batteries, VRLA batteries have a valve that controls the release of gas if the internal pressure becomes too high. This valve-regulation system ensures safety and helps maintain optimal battery performance over time. Inside the battery, there’s an absorptive glass mat (AGM) or gel that absorbs the electrolyte (a mixture of sulfuric acid and water). This makes the battery spill-proof, even when tilted or subjected to rough handling.

The AGM or gel inside ensures that the electrolyte stays in place, preventing leaks and enabling a more efficient energy storage process. This design allows VRLA batteries to work well in harsh environments, providing reliable power storage with minimal maintenance. The sealed construction and valve-regulated mechanism combine to make VRLA batteries one of the safest and most durable options for energy storage.

Why VRLA Batteries are Popular in India

As VRLA battery manufacturers in India like Goldstar India continue to expand their reach, the demand for these batteries has skyrocketed. India’s energy demand is rapidly growing, with power outages still common in many parts of the country. VRLA batteries provide an ideal solution by offering a reliable backup without the need for regular maintenance, making them perfect for rural areas or places where technical support is limited.

In India, VRLA batteries are used in solar energy systems, inverters, and automotive applications, providing essential backup power when the grid fails. The low-maintenance feature is particularly important, as it reduces the need for ongoing monitoring and servicing, making them highly convenient in areas with limited technical expertise.
